Action item from the Glimmerquery relevance incident: our tuning notes were scattered across three decks, and plugin authors shipped rankers against stale weights. Going forward, all boost factors, synonym maps, and decay curves get recorded in one canonical doc, versioned per release. If your plugin touches scoring, check it before every publish. The consolidated tuning notes now live at the internal page below.

runbook for badug-kadup: https://confluence.zemvarlabs.internal/projects/browse/display/projects/bd1b

# Artifact Signing — Fleet Fuel-Usage Report

The weekly fleet fuel-usage report produced by Tallowline is distributed as a signed archive so downstream consumers can verify it was not altered after generation. Release managers must confirm the signature timestamp falls within the generation window before approving publication; mismatches indicate a stale artifact. Signing is performed at the final packaging stage using the report pipeline's dedicated identity, reproduced below.

signing key of bagap-yawep = bky13_TbfT6ZMUoGJo2

## Build Provenance: ImageCache Leak in Renderlet 4.2

Plugin authors consuming the Renderlet thumbnail pipeline should be aware that builds prior to 4.2.7 carried a memory leak in the shared image cache. Evicted bitmap handles were retained by the provenance recorder, growing heap usage roughly 2 MB per thousand thumbnails. The fix landed in the Quillmark build farm on the 4.2.7 line; any plugin pinned to an earlier artifact should rebuild. To confirm your artifact includes the patch, verify it against the provenance token below.

pipeline stamp: htk9_ce63042d9